Output d761e042ed8aae1e44278dbcf45bdca30b600efdeaee462bc5748b367973f576:44

value
2564621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 087db9b89d59bc8353130f0fb8657e2c70f37a38 OP_EQUAL
address
32TuwdvYXCiMfPbWPhADhz1Rv3jGgUSXMp
transaction
d761e042ed8aae1e44278dbcf45bdca30b600efdeaee462bc5748b367973f576
spent
true